simple rule of booking outcalls sweetie ...

1 - dont do outcalls to residential locations untill you have seen the client a few times .
2 - dont answer the phone if number witheld to start with .
3 - Take Hotel Name, Room Number, Name room booked in ... then call the hotel reception to confirm it is genuine ..
4 - leave hotel details/. booking details with a friend . and an agreed time to call etc .

thats how i work outcalls .. x
